The house is in a good condition. The house is small but still good enough for a small family. Sauna is anice addition to the amenities, especially after a day at slopes. The heating does its jib, it was warm but we still used additional blankets which were available in the drawers. As a tip: 1) Make sure to bring essentials like tea, salt, sugar, oil with u, as well as products if you're planning to cook. 2)The transfer is at 9am to the ski zone and at 4pm back. If you're not an early bird - u have to go by car and pay for parking closer to the slopes (4-8 euros depending on time and parking location). Overall, nice and quite getaway, in the firset area with a country-lije spirit.

The reception desk staff were very friendly and helpful. My shower drain was clogged and they had it fixed the next morning. The facility is beautiful and clean. The one problem was the staff running the hot tubs. They made the water soooo hot that you could cook a chicken in it so no one was able to use the hot tubs for hours. The kitchenette was good because we prefer home cooked meals but there was one bowl, 4 tiny plates, 1 knife, 4 forks and 4 spoons. If you plan on cooking you need to bring everything from pots and pans, oil, spices and cooking utensils. Overall though, the place was great and we will return.

Hot tubs and sauna amazing . Well maintained and the fire to keep them warm is kept going all day by a staff member. Rooms very cosy. 5 minute cab ride to the slopes 20 lev the receptionist gives you the number . Don’t wait more than 10 minutes for a cab to arrive. Restaurant food was decent and plenty of drink options for a very reasonable price. Would 100% stay again.
